## v4.12.3

- Fixed query planner regression introduced in v4.12.0: Larkspur's cost model underestimated nested-loop joins on partitioned tables, causing 40x slowdowns on the Quillbrook reporting workload.
- Reverted heuristic from change 4411; added regression test suite under planner/partitions.
- Do not re-enable the heuristic without benchmarking. Questions about the fix and future planner changes go to the maintainer named below.

signatory, yagap-bawig: Ulaath Eliath

## Authentication

Spindrift is the internal secrets-rotation utility for the Coppervale platform. It runs as a scheduled job but can be invoked manually during incidents. All invocations authenticate against the Vaultrelay service; there is no anonymous mode. If rotation stalls mid-cycle, re-run with the resume flag rather than restarting, since partial rotations leave services on mixed credentials. The on-call credential is scoped to rotation operations only and expires after 24 hours. Authenticate your session with the key below.

app token of tadug-yahag = vxb3-949

## Deployment: Fan-out Backpressure

Bristlecone's notification bus applies backpressure when plugin consumers lag. Slow consumers get throttled, not dropped; messages queue up to the configured depth, then oldest-first shedding begins. Plugins must ack within the deadline or the dispatcher halves their delivery rate. Tune nothing client-side; the limits live in the service config. Current production values for the fan-out stage follow.

service settings:
HOLDOR_PIN=6477
HOLDOR_METRICS_HOST=metrics.holdor.nelvrocorp.corp
HOLDOR_LOG_LEVEL=error
HOLDOR_TENANT=noviel

- [ ] **Step 7: Breaker override escrow.** After sealing the signing keys for the Tallgrove upstream API circuit breaker, confirm the support team can force the breaker open during a full outage. The override bundle lives in the sealed escrow drawer and is useless without its unlock phrase. Two ceremony witnesses must initial this step before proceeding. The escrow bundle is decrypted with the recovery passphrase that follows.

vault phrase of kahip-kahop = holath-quenmir